Yes, and it depends on the specifics. Text PDFs that have been created correctly -- and that seems to include the majority of online professional publications -- can almost always be converted via Calibre to entirely readable ePubs.
That's just in my experience, but I've done this dozens of times. The results are usually not perfect, but they're definitely highly readable.
If there are pictures and graphs, fuhgedaboudit. But for a lot of PDF documents, the results are usable.

yup, mostly text based pdfs convert well but of course there are exceptions.
1) for texts which contain non-Latin characters
2) 2 column pdfs. They do not convert well with calibre but i heard amazon's own service handles them well too.
in any case kindle DXG is enough for mostly text based pdfs with its own software or with Duokan in some cases.
